: Watercolour of the lower register of the astronomical ceiling of Pharaoh Sety I's burial chamber. Yellow images on a black background, the original on a curved ceiling. Left to right are figures, with their names alongside them in hieroglyphs; Serqet (a female figure shown horizontally, she is a scorpion goddess associated with fertility); a 'Divine Lion who is between them' (a lion with stars on its back); 'The Gatherer' (a human figure with a crocodile); Meskhetyu (The Great Bear / Plough); Anu (a falcon headed man holding a stick or spear), and a standing hippopotamus('The mother is fierce'). Astronomical ceiling decoration allowed the ba of Sety I to fly up into the sky. Hornung Room K
